Chelsea to sign Norwich’s Alex Matos on a free transfer after the 18-year-old forward informed the Championship club of his intentions to leave.
Premier League giants Chelsea have reportedly reached an agreement in principle with Norwich City for the signing of promising youngster Alex Matos on a free transfer this summer.
As per reliable sources, the 18-year-old forward’s contract with the Championship side is set to expire at the end of the current campaign, and he has informed his current employers of his desire to leave upon its conclusion.
Matos, a native of England, has been a product of the Norwich City academy, progressing through the ranks to establish himself as a regular for the club’s Under-18s team. The young forward made his debut for the academy side last season and has been a key player for them ever since.
This potential acquisition is the latest in a series of changes being made to the Chelsea setup behind the scenes. It remains to be seen how Matos will fit into the club’s plans, but his potential and youthfulness make him an exciting prospect for the Blues.
